What is the definition of caricature in the Oxford dictionary?
In the Oxford dictionary, a caricature is defined as a humorous or exaggerated drawing or description of a person, typically highlighting their distinctive features or mannerisms.

What is the definition of 'comic' according to the Oxford Dictionary?
The Oxford Dictionary defines 'comic' as something intended to be humorous or causing laughter, often in the form of a story or drawing.

What is the definition of caricature according to the Oxford English Dictionary?
According to the Oxford English Dictionary, a caricature is a humorous or satirical drawing, representation, or description that exaggerates or distorts the features or characteristics of a person or thing.

What is the definition of science fiction according to the Oxford Dictionary?
Well, the Oxford Dictionary defines science fiction as a literary or cinematic genre that explores fictional scientific or technological advancements and their potential impact on society and human beings. It often involves speculative elements and takes us to imagined futures or otherworldly settings.
